What These Tests In fact Evaluate (And Why Universities Insist on Them)

Educational screening experts who may have administered thousands of these assessments report that a lot of parents fully misunderstand what these checks reveal.

The WPPSI-IV and WISC-V Never just evaluate "intelligence" in certain vague, standard perception. They supply an in depth cognitive blueprint that shows exactly how your son or daughter's thoughts procedures info.

The WPPSI-IV examines five distinctive cognitive domains in young kids. Verbal comprehension reveals how effectively they recognize and use language to precise complex Tips. Visual spatial capabilities exhibit their expertise for examining Visible styles and resolving spatial puzzles. Fluid reasoning demonstrates their potential for reasonable wondering and novel problem-solving. Functioning memory signifies how properly they could keep and manipulate information and facts of their minds. Processing speed steps their mental performance and precision beneath time tension.

The WISC-V handles equivalent cognitive territories but with elevated complexity suitable for more mature kids. It evaluates verbal comprehension for stylish language skills, Visible spatial processing for advanced spatial reasoning, fluid reasoning for summary imagining, Doing the job memory for sustained focus and psychological Management, and processing speed for cognitive performance.

The Hidden Patterns That Expose Mastering Type

Probably the most important facets of in depth cognitive testing is definitely the Perception it offers into your son or daughter's special Discovering fashion. The pattern of scores across unique cognitive domains tells a Tale regarding how your son or daughter's brain is effective finest.

Think about this example from a latest assessment: A seven-calendar year-outdated showed Excellent fluid reasoning and visual spatial abilities but struggled with processing speed. This sample suggested a child who excels at complicated difficulty-solving but requirements extra time for you to exhibit their capabilities. Armed using this type of information and facts, the household could discover universities that emphasized depth more than pace of their tutorial technique.

Yet another youngster shown remarkable verbal comprehension but regular Functioning memory. This profile indicated a student who thrives in dialogue-based mostly Studying but might will need assist with multi-stage Guidance or intricate assignments. Knowing this sample assisted the family opt for faculties noted for their collaborative, discussion-loaded school rooms.
